How It Works: From Discovery to Thriving
The Kibbi onboarding process takes four weeks and requires no technical work from your team.
Week 1: Discovery Call
We learn about your current setup, member base, employer base, and goals. We discuss branding, domain setup, and any integrations you need (CRM, HRIS, email provider). You're assigned a dedicated account manager.
Week 2–3: Build and Migrate
Our team sets up your white-label platform, migrates your existing job postings (if any), and configures your branding. We handle all technical work. You review and approve the design.
Week 4: Soft Launch and Training
We launch a private version so your team can test. We train your admins on moderation, employer onboarding, and analytics. You go live.
Ongoing: Growth and Support
Your account manager checks in monthly, shares performance reports, suggests optimisations, and helps you recruit employers and promote the board to members.
